About the role

The Department of Biology and Environmental Sciences at Auburn University at Montgomery is seeking to fill a tenure-track Assistant Professor position in Biology. This position will enhance existing research strengths in molecular biology, cancer biology, microbiology or physiology, and will support a dynamic department and a growing MS program in Biochemistry and Molecular Biology.

Responsibilities

  • Pursue research topics emphasizing training in biomedicine or biotechnology, with particular interest in areas related to cancer, immunology, and metabolomics.
  • Develop a funded research program involving undergraduate and graduate students.
  • Teach undergraduate and graduate courses, and mentor first-generation students.
  • Employ innovative, evidence-based, and inclusive pedagogical practices.

Requirements

  • A Ph.D. in Biology, Molecular Biology, Cancer Biology, Microbiology, or Physiology, with postdoctoral experience preferred.
  • Demonstrated ability to secure external funding.
  • Experience teaching undergraduate and graduate courses.
  • A strong commitment to mentoring first-generation students.
